Understanding Home Oxygen Concentrators (HOCs)

In this section, we are going to provide a deep comprehension of home oxygen concentrators (HOCs) as well as the vital support they provide to individuals with respiratory conditions. Home oxygen concentrators are medical devices that help deliver a concentrated circulation of oxygen to patients with low blood oxygen levels.

How HOCs Function and Offer Vital Support

Everflo Q (靜音型) 5L 家用型氧氣機-Philips Respironics concentrators function by extracting oxygen from the surrounding air and delivering it towards the patient via a nasal cannula or face mask. These devices utilize advanced technology to filter out nitrogen along with other impurities, providing a very high purity oxygen flow to support respiratory function.

HOCs are very important for individuals with ch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), pneumonia, asthma, along with other respiratory conditions. They provide a continuous and reliable source of oxygen, allowing patients to breathe easier and take part in daily activities with greater comfort and independence.

Determining the Correct Liter Flow To Meet Your Needs

One essential aspect to think about when utilizing a home oxygen concentrator is determining the correct liter flow. Liter circulation refers back to the rate at which oxygen is sent to the individual in liters a minute (LPM). The prescribed liter flow depends on the seriousness of the respiratory condition and also the individual’s oxygen requirements.

A healthcare professional will assess your oxygen needs through various tests and examinations. They will determine the ideal liter circulation to keep adequate blood oxygen saturation levels and improve overall respiratory function. It is essential to adhere to the prescribed liter circulation to ensure the maximum advantages of oxygen therapy.

Comparison Between Home and Portable Oxygen Concentrators

When considering an oxygen concentrator, it is crucial to understand the differences between home and transportable models. Home oxygen concentrators are equipped for use primarily at home or perhaps in similar settings. These are larger and provide a continuous flow of oxygen, making them suitable for individuals who require oxygen therapy each day and night.

In the other hand, easily transportable oxygen concentrators are lighter, smaller, and battery-operated, allowing patients to move freely and participate in activities outside the home. Portable concentrators typically offer pulse dose oxygen delivery, delivering oxygen only if the patient inhales, conserving battery life and ensuring efficient oxygen therapy.

Understanding the distinctions between home and lightweight oxygen concentrators can help individuals choose the best option based on their lifestyle, mobility needs, and oxygen therapy requirements.

The Disadvantages in Consider Before Purchasing a HOC

While home oxygen concentrators (HOCs) offer many benefits, it’s essential to consider the downsides before making a acquisition. Below are a few important considerations and potential challenges to keep in mind:

  1. Noisy Operation: Some HOCs could be loud during operation, which may cause disturbances and impact the overall convenience the consumer.
  2. Power Dependence: HOCs depend on electricity to operate, so power outages or interruptions can impact their usage. It’s essential to have a backup power plan in place to ensure continuous oxygen supply.
  3. Portability Limitations: While transportable oxygen concentrators are available, they might have limitations on battery life and oxygen circulation rate. This could restrict mobility, particularly for individuals who require higher oxygen levels.
  4. Initial Cost: Home oxygen concentrators can have a significant upfront cost. It’s important to consider your budget and evaluate the long-term cost-effectiveness when compared with other oxygen delivery options.
  5. Regular Maintenance: HOCs require routine maintenance, including filter replacements, to make sure optimal performance. This ongoing maintenance may involve additional time as well as costs.

By acknowledging these downsides and thoroughly evaluating your own personal needs and circumstances, you can make an educated decision when purchasing a home oxygen concentrator.

Setting Up Your Home Oxygen Machine for Optimal Use

In order to ensure the ideal use of your home oxygen machine, you should properly set it up and sustain it. Here are a few placement and maintenance tips to help you get the most out of your machine:

Placement and Maintenance Tips For Your HOC

  1. Location: Place your home oxygen machine within a well-ventilated area that is from heat sources, like heaters or sunlight. This helps prevent overheating and ensure proper functioning.
  2. Avoid Obstructions: Make certain you will find no objects blocking the air vents in the machine. This may enable adequate airflow and prevent potential damage to the system.
  3. Secure Placement: Place the machine over a stable surface to stop any accidental tipping or falling. This will help keep up with the integrity of the machine and minimize the chance of damage.
  4. Cleanliness: Regularly clean the outside of the equipment having a soft, damp cloth to get rid of any dust or debris. Be sure to stick to the manufacturer’s guidelines to clean and maintenance.
  5. Regular Inspection: Periodically inspect the tubing, filters, and connections for just about any warning signs of wear or damage. Replace any worn-out parts as recommended by the manufacturer.
  6. Electrical Safety: Ensure that the electrical cords are certainly not damaged and they are connected to a properly grounded outlet. Avoid using extension cords to power the machine.

The Best Way To Integrate Humidification for Comfortable Use

Integrating humidification in your home oxygen therapy can help enhance comfort and stop dryness or irritation in the respiratory system. Follow these steps to integrate humidification:

  1. Pick a compatible humidifier: Pick a humidifier that works with your home oxygen machine. Talk to your healthcare provider or even the manufacturer for recommendations.
  2. Set up the humidifier: Adhere to the manufacturer’s instructions for connecting the humidifier to your home oxygen machine. Ensure that all connections are secure.
  3. Fill the humidifier: Fill the humidifier with distilled water as directed. Avoid using tap water, as it might contain minerals that can harm the machine or create deposits in the tubing.
  4. Adjust the humidifier settings: Adjust the humidifier settings according to your comfort level as well as the recommendations of your own healthcare provider. Monitor the humidity levels regularly.
  5. Clean and maintain the humidifier: Clean the humidifier regularly in accordance with the manufacturer’s instructions to stop the expansion of bacteria or mold. Replace the water daily and disinfect the humidifier as recommended.

By following these placement and maintenance tips, along with integrating humidification in your home oxygen therapy, you are able to make sure the safe and comfy usage of your home oxygen machine.
